Sounds good to me.  How about an inline-docs/code-cleanup commit  
person?  :-)
That person could be in charge of reviewing submitted inline-docs and  
code-cleanup submissions and committing them.  They could also review  
patches for other items to make sure they they conform to the coding  
guidelines and have proper tab-indentation, whitespace, if ( 'foo' ==  
$bar ) etc.  Sounds like menial labor, I know, but I'd love to do it.
